Quote:
Originally posted by pod
Isn't there an OpenNap client yet that can multisource over the protocol via the resume mechanism? OpenNap servers can have registered nicks, and the scheme wouldn't inconvinience people who wish to use other servers at the same time.
Even if OpenNap can be tricked to do multisourcing like you say, the major problem with OpenNap is the poor hashing mechanism. It hashes only the first 300 kb of each file - which may be helpful in finding candidates for single source resuming but is not nearly enough for reliable multisourcing. Especially larger files - and we are talking gigabyte movies here - require full-file hashing, preferably in the form of hash trees or other similar constructs so that smaller sections of the file can be verified as soon as they arrive without having to wait for the completition of the entire file.
